1X2 Match Betting
This is the most popular betting market for the First League. Here, one is simply wagering on the Full-Time result of a given match: 1 – a Home Win, X – a Draw, 2 – an Away win.
Double Chance Betting
This is a variation of typical 1X2 match betting whereby one selects any two of the three possible outcomes: 1,X – Home Win or Draw. X,2 - Draw or Away Win. 1,2 - Home Win or Away Win. This allows for a hedging of one’s bet. In doing so, the odds will be lower than for a typical 1X2 match result odds.
For American odds format, there are two sets of expressions to remember, but both revolve around the figure of $100. First, negative numbers express odds that are below even-money and thus show how much one needs to wager in order to win a profit of $100. When one sees a negative number like Sparta Prague to win at -225, this means that one would need to stake $225 in order to win a profit of $100, for a total return of $325. When the odds are above even, American odds format display a positive figure which expresses how much one may win when $100 is staked. For example, match odds of +395 for a draw means that a stake of $100 wins $395 in profit for a total return of $495. Note that this $100 figure is neither a requirement nor a limit for what stake you must make. It is purely for expression, you may stake what you please. For example, a $20 stake with the same +395 odds would return $79 profit, or $99 total return.
For Decimal odds format, the odds express the full amount that will be returned on your wager including the stake amount - simply multiply the odds by the stake. For example, if Viktoria Plzen is listed to win at 1.91, a $100 bet would return a total of $191 including your stake, so the profit is $91. A draw with decimal odds of 3.60 would return $180 on a bet of $50, a profit of $130. (Total return equals $50 X 3.60)
For Fractional format, the odds express the amount of profit that will be returned on a wager. So for example, with a wager of $100 and odds of 8/11 (said eight-to-eleven) on Slovacko to win, one would see a profit of $72.72 ($100 X 8/11) plus the stake for a total return of $172.72.
